Where Did Loretta Lynn Die?

Where Loretta Lynn Died and Verified Details

Loretta Lynn died at her home in Hurricane Mills, Tennessee, on October 4, 2022. Her family confirmed the location and stated she passed away peacefully, surrounded by loved ones. The country music icon and lifelong resident had been in declining health for some time. Below are verified details, context, and reliable sourcing to clarify where and how she died.

Place of Death: Hurricane Mills, Tennessee

Hurricane Mills is a small unincorporated community in rural Humphreys County, Tennessee, where Lynn lived for decades. The Lynn family property includes the ranch that operates as a tourist destination and museum. Her longtime residence on-site served as her primary home in her later years. Multiple family and official statements confirm this location as her place of death.

Circumstances and Timing

Lynn had been in declining health for some time before her death but was able to spend her final days at home. Reports indicated she passed away peacefully and without incident. The location was never in doubt among family and close associates, though official confirmation took a short period after her passing.
